Step-by-step explanation: You are given the relation R = {(-3, -2), (-3, 0), (-1, 2), (1, 2)} The domain of the relation are all possible inputs and the range of the relation are all possible outputs. So, the inputs are : -3,-1,1; and the outputs are : -2,0,2. As a result, the domain is : -3,-1,1; and the range is : -2,0,2.

The total cost of 5 kg rice and 6 kg sugar is Rs 940. If the
rate of rice increases by 20% and the rate of sugar decreases
by 10%, the total cost of 4 kg rice and 3 kg sugar will be
Rs 627. By what percent the cost of 1 kg rice is more or less
than the cost of 1 kg sugar. Find it.
The percent cost of 1 kg rice is less than the cost of 1 kg sugar by 11 1/9%.
What is percent increase?We first calculate the difference between the original value and the new value when comparing a rise in a quantity over time. The relative increase in comparison to the initial value is then determined using this difference, and it is expressed as a percentage.
Let the cost price of rice is R and cost price of sugar is S.
Case 1 : total cost of 5 kg rice and 6 kg sugar is Rs. 940.
5R + 6S = 940 ...(1)
Case 2 : rate of rice increased by 20% and the rate of sugar decreased by 10%.
The new cost price of rice = R + 20% of R = 1.2R
The new cost price of sugar = S - 10% of S = 0.9S
So, the total cost of 4 kg rice and 3 kg sugar will be Rs. 627.
Thus,
4 × 1.2R + 3 × 0.9S = 4.8R + 2.7S = 627 ..(2)
From equations (1) and (2) we have,
(5R + 6S)/(4.8R + 2.7R) = 940/627
R/S = 8/9
Hence, if the price of rice is 8 then the price of sugar is 9.
It is clear that the price of sugar is more than that of rice.
The percent cost by which cost of rice is less than sugar is:
(9 - 8)/ 9 (100) = 11 1/9%.
Hence, the cost of 1 kg rice is less than the cost of 1 kg sugar by 11 1/9%.

Elyas is on holiday in Greece.
He wants to buy a pair of sunglasses for €90
The exchange rate is €1 = £0.875
Elyas says, "The sunglasses cost less than £70"
Using a suitable approximation, show that Elyas is wrong.
Answer:
To convert euros to pounds, we have to multiply the amount in euros by the exchange rate. So, the sunglasses cost 90 * 0.875 = 78.75 pounds.
To use a suitable approximation, we can round the exchange rate to the nearest hundredth, which is 0.88. This makes the calculation easier and gives a close estimate of the actual value.
Using the rounded exchange rate, the sunglasses cost 90 * 0.88 = 79.2 pounds.
We can see that both the exact and the approximate values are greater than 70 pounds, so Elyas is wrong. The sunglasses cost more than 70 pounds

The mean is the quatient between the sum of all the data and the number of data, then:
\(\begin{gathered} \frac{68+84+75+81+77+72+71+67+71}{9}=\frac{666}{9} \\ =74 \end{gathered}\)To find the median we need to order the data:
67, 68, 71, 71, 72, 75, 77, 81, 84
Once we ordered the data the median is central value, in this case 72.
The mode is the value that repeats itself more, in this case 71.
The range is the substraction between the lowest and highest value, then:
\(84-67=17\)Summing up:
Mean: 74
Median: 72
Mode: 71
Range: 17
